The Tower of London River Tour boat, the Silver Raven, was built especially for the new 40-minute circular river tours.

The official Tower of London River Tour, on board what is being described as the UK’s first electric tour boat, is now open for bookings. 

A collaboration between Historic Royal Palaces and Woods Tours, the tour takes passengers on a journey London’s history along the River Thames.

Martha Howe-Douglas, co-creator of BBC’s Ghosts, has narrated the 40-minute river tour which has been curated by Historic Royal Palaces and is delivered live by guides on board.

Starting at Tower Bridge, the circular cruise will take groups to the Houses of Parliament, highlighting the city’s iconic landmarks and their histories, highlighting connections to the infamous fortress where the tour begins.

The electric boat, the Silver Raven, was built at Pendennis shipyard in Cornwall especially for the collaboration and is said to represent modern British shipbuilding and sustainable tourism. Its interior subtly links the river to the Tower of London and echoes the heyday of city river cruising.

The River Thames has been central to the Tower of London’s story for centuries, serving as both a lifeline and a path to power and infamy.

The new tour ensures an authentic historical experience with modern cultural references, reflecting the deep connection between the Tower and the river.
